After Christmas time, the Maxxis FIM SuperEnduro World Championship is back on Saturday, January 18th in the Football and Samba country and more precisely in Belo Horizonte in the Mineirinho Arena for the 3rd stage of the season… It will be also the first “oversea” race for the Maxxis FIM SuperEnduro World Championship that never went out of Europa before. For the very first time in its history, Brazil will welcome a SuperEnduro stage. It’s the Quanta Sports agency, well-known in the Motorbike World for their organization of riding traineeship with David KNIGHT or Graham JARVIS, which is in charge to organize this event in collaboration with the FIM, ABC Communication and the CBM (Confederacao Brasileira de Motociclismo). Sebastiao LAGO, chairman of Quanta Sports, has decided to use the success of the 2013 X-Games (Foz do Iguacu) to organize this SEWC stage. “The craze in Belo Horizonte is very important for this race! The spectators and motorbike fans are coming from everywhere in the country in order to watch KNIGHT, BLAZUSIAK and the other stars. It’s a big chance for us to promote the Motorsports in Brazil and I think that every European rider will be surprised by the warm welcome and the fervor that await them. Besides the races, we have organized other activities with for example a concert!” And the Mineirinho Arena of Belo Horizonte has been chosen to welcome this Grand Prix. This arena is the biggest one in Brazil and can host 25 000 persons! It is situated next to the Mineirao stadium that will host some games and a semi-final of the next 2014 Football World Cup. Mineirinho has welc omed numerous events like UFC fights or the Brazil Cup of Volleyball and also many concerts (Iron Maiden, Green Day, and Rihanna). In other words, it’s a perfect arena to host the 3rd stage of the 2013/2014 SEWC! Belo Horizonte, “BH” as Brazilian used to call it is also the hometown of Dilma ROUSSEF, the actual Brazilian President… T 2013 didn’t end up as expected for Taddy BLAZUSIAK (PL – KTM). Defeated at home in Lodz (Poland) in front of his public by David KNIGHT (GB – Sherco), the KTM rider confessed he was tired of a long season. After four weeks free, the four times World Champion must be 100% fit and will look of course to dig his gap (14 points) over KNIGHT… But strong from a nice victory that gave him more confidence, KNIGHTER should be more incisive and will have only one goal: to get another win in order to come back on Taddy… This duel will once again give a lot of thrill to the boiling Brazilian spectators. Behind this magic duo, start of season sensation Dani GIBERT (E – Gas Gas) will look to come to play spoilsport. More and more present in the head of the race (5/1/8 in Poland), the Spanish will try to fight with BLAZUSIAK and KNIGHT… Always consistent and good placed the HVA rider Alfredo GOMEZ (E) is still looking for his first podium of the season and real wants to reach it this Saturday evening! O his side, Jonny WALKER (GB – KTM), diminished in the Atlas Arena due to an injury during the qualification heat, will have to step up if he doesn’t want to see the Top 3 escape to him. After an excellent and surprising Grand Prix of Poland, Mathias BELLINO (F – HVA) will have to confirm his nice results while Joakim LJUNGGREN (S – HVA) has still to give a lot more in order to affirm himself as a top gun of the class. Exciting actors in Liverpool and Lodz, it seems that it’s only missing a podium from Kyle REDMOND (USA – KTM) and Kevin ROOKSTOOL (USA – KTM) to launch definitely their season… Benoit FORTUNATO (F – Yam) and Ricky DIETRICH (USA – KTM) are also making the trip to South America and are still looking to continue their learning of the discipline after scoring 6 encouraging point in Poland for the French. Will Alfredo GOMEZ (E - HVA) claim his first podium of the season? Giacomo REDONDI will dance Samba In the Junior class, we are wondering who will stop Giacomo REDONDI (I – Beta). Indeed, the new Beta rider will be the only European to make the trip to the samba and football country as Jamie MCCANNEY (GB – HVA), Andreas LINUSSON (S – KTM), Magnus THOR (S – KTM) and Pawel SZYMKOWSKI (PL – KTM) has decided to overlook the South American tour… But the class will still be very interesting and we’ll have the opportunity to discover the Brazilian young guns leaded by Ripi GALLILEU (Gas Gas), Breno FELNER (TM) and Ronald SANTI (HM Honda)… For its great first out of Europa, we will attend to a thrilling third stage that can be the turning point of this Championship where everything can change.
